										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span style="color: #e67b35"><strong>This COREOPSIS EXTRACT from OCCITANIA is a dye-plant extract from Coreopsis (<em>Coreopsis tinctoria</em> Nutt.), source of natural colour. The plants are grown locally under organic conditions. The aerial parts are harvested and dried without heating energy (thanks to the hot air of the South of France in summer). This NEW natural orange powder dye is manufactured in our new extracting unit using revised processes and has its own characteristics.</strong></span></p>
<p>100 % natural dye.<br />
Thanks to its origin, it is adapted for cultivation in Mediterranean climate, where it can fully express its dye potential. Our organic farming practices contribute to keep plant and animal biodiversity, genetic diversity and, of course, to soil protection.</p>
<p>Main components : The main dye molecules are chalcones and aurones, family of flavonoids.</p>
<p><strong><span style="color: #000000">Uses :</span><br />
</strong><span style="text-decoration: underline">Natural dyeing and textile printing</span> : This extract can be used up to 20% WOF (mean use 5-10% WOF), depending on the depth of shade. It can be used on any kind of fiber and can be combined to any other natural dyes and mordants to provide a large range of orange shades. The shades obtained can vary depending on the pH. <span class="HwtZe" lang="en"><span class="jCAhz ChMk0b"><span class="ryNqvb">The most interesting shades are obtained at pH 4-7</span></span></span>.</p>
<p><span style="text-decoration: underline">Fine arts, creative leisure &amp; decoration</span> : <span class="HwtZe" lang="en"><span class="jCAhz ChMk0b"><span class="ryNqvb">This extract also allows the manufacture of your own natural inks, your own pigment or coreopsis lacquer for fine painting, watercolor, oil… or for incorporation into materials.</span></span></span></p>

<p><strong><span style="color: #000000">The plant :<br />
</span></strong>Dyer&#8217;s coreopsis, <em>Coreopsis tinctoria</em> Nutt., is native of Central America.</p>
<p><span class="HwtZe" lang="en"><span class="jCAhz ChMk0b"><span class="ryNqvb">This plant was used by pre-Columbian civilizations and Native Americans of the central United States as a source of dye and in traditional medicine</span></span></span>.</p>
